基于软启动原理的发电机组调压器的设计与研究  

Design and Research on Soft Start Function of Voltage Regulator for Generator Set

摘  要:异步电动机的启动电流通常是额定电流的3倍以上,发电机组直接启动较大功率异步电动机时,将加大对发电机组的功率要求,如采用变频器等软启动方式启动异步电动机,势必增加较大成本。针对上述问题,采用基于单片机技术的PID控制算法对发电机组的调压器控制系统进行优化,并根据调压器的工作原理,对控制电路及控制流程进行优化设计,实现了发电机组对异步电动机的软启动功能,且有效地提高了发电机组启动异步电动机的能力。The starting current of asynchronous motor is usually more than 3 times of the rated current.When the generator set is used to start the asynchronous motor directly,the power requirement on the generator set will be increased.If the soft start mode such as frequency converter is used to start the asynchronous motor,the cost will be increased.According to the above problems,the voltage regulator control system of the generator is optimized by the PID control algorithm based on MCU technology,and the control circuit and the control process is also optimized according to the working principle of the voltage regulator to realize the soft start function of the generator set to the asynchronous motor,and improve the ability of the generator set to start the asynchronous motor effectively.
